What is your process for creating sculptures?
Our process for creating sculptures typically involves starting with sketches and/or small models to finalize the design. Then we create a larger clay or wax model, which is then cast in the desired material. The sculpture is then finished with any necessary details and patina application.Can you provide examples of your previous works and their respective prices?

Beautiful sculpture called “the Lioness and a Lesser Kudu” located in the upper Grosvenor GardenS. It was a commission for the Duke of Westminster. There is another cast in the grounds of Eaton Hall, the Duke of Westminster's estate in Cheshire

This action packed, high speed chase/piece of public art called Lioness and Lesser Kudu was created by famous British Sculptor and artist Jonathan Kenworthy. While most of us only enjoy African safaris and taking pictures of animals, Jonathan goes a step further to present the thrill of the chase in a very different way. This clearly shows his main area of interest which is wildlife. Its a taste of Africa in very 'civilised' part of London. The only reason its here because It was commissioned by Duke of Westminster Gerald Grosvenor who owns probably all Grosvenor and Cavendish Square area where this sculpture sits.
